DateLine: 17th January 2011
Lancashire League champions Ramsbottom have signed New Zealander Shanan Stewart as their new professional. The club moved for the former East Lancs paid man after their original signing Francois du Plessis was singed by Chennai Super Kings for the Indian Premier League which would have kept the South African occupied until June.
 
There was also the possibility of du Plessis being signed by a county for the English Twenty20 competition so Ramsbottom opted for the 28 year-old Stewart. 
Stewart had an outstanding first season in the league with East Lancs in 2007, scoring 1069 runs at 62.9 with two centuries and eleven fifties. Stewart also picked up 57 wickets at 18.4. His best batting and bowling figures came in the same match when he scored 133 and took 8-34 in a fantastic all round display at Church on June 16th. He also led the side to victory in the Get Solutions Worsley Cup Final against Bacup. 
Not surprisingly, East Lancs re-signed the Canterbury batsman for 2008. Unfortunately he had to return home for a hernia operation in mid June after playing in 9 matches during which he totalled 435 runs at 62.1 and he also took 24 wickets at 18.8. He opened the season in prime form with the ball, taking 8-312 at Bacup. He also played one of the outstanding innings of the season, hitting a superb unbeaten 137 to almost single-handedly win the match against Rishton. 
Stewart will be Ramsbottom's third professional from New Zealand following Chris Harris and Lou Vincent.
